我想将一列中的文本分成两个独立的列。
列应以以下变量Performance
,Learning & Growth
和分隔Business
。
| AM | AN | AO |
|---------------------------------------------|-------------------|------------------------|
| Performance comment | Performance | comment |
| Learning & Growth some comment | Learning & Growth | some comment |
| Business This is third comment | Business | This is third comment |
| Performance This is fourth comment | Performance | This is fourth comment |
我试过数据工具>文本分列。但是这行不通Learning & Growth
。
感谢您的时间和考虑
编辑: 我可以分开上文使用以下公式的评论
=TRIM(LEFT(AM2, SEARCH(CHAR(10),AM2,1)-1)))
但我无法分裂下方文字
=RIGHT(AM2,LEN(AN2)-FIND(" ",AM2))
这给了我值错误
答案1
HYG 使用公式来实现这一目的的方法:
- 用下划线、井号或任何唯一字符替换变量中的任何空格。例如:变量“Learning & Growth”应为“Learning_&_Growth”
- 可以通过 CTRL + H > 完成找什么盒型学习与成长”,并且在用。。。来代替盒型 “学习与成长”。
- 假设要拆分的文本位于 A 列。将以下公式放在相邻列中
=LEFT(A1, SEARCH(" ",A1,1)-1)
- 将以下公式放在下一个相邻列中
=RIGHT(A1,(LEN(A1)-FIND(" ",A1)))
第一个公式将提取变量名称,因为它提取第一个空格之前的任何字符。
第二个公式将根据需要提取变量名后的文本。